Law Enforcement National Security

The Counter Intelligence Wing of the India===Punjab Police, in cooperation with ATS India===Gujarat, successfully busted an ISI-backed terror module. Three individuals, Sarabjit Singh, Bikramjit Singh, and Amandeep Singh, were arrested, and two hand grenades along with a Glock pistol were recovered. The recovered grenades bore markings of Pakistan===Pakistan Ordnance Factories, indicating cross-border linkages. Preliminary investigations revealed that the module, backed by Pakistan's Pakistan===Inter-Services Intelligence, was planning systematic grenade attacks on police establishments across multiple states, including India===Punjab. Bikramjit Singh was identified as the key operative and primary contact for Pakistan Intelligence Operatives, operating from Deesa in India===Gujarat. The accused were in touch with Pakistan Intelligence Operatives via social media platforms. This operation successfully averted the planned attacks, and efforts are ongoing to identify and apprehend other members of the module.
